South Dakota Softball travels to Conway, Arkansas to compete Friday and Saturday at the Adam Brown Memorial Shamrock Classic in Central Arkansas. The Coyotes face Iowa, Central Arkansas (twice) and Alcorn State at Farris Field.

South Dakota (5-8, 0-0 peaks)
The Coyotes won 2-3 in Arizona last week and played six games in Texas the weekend before. South Dakota is offensively led by the catcher Bela Gorke and right fielder Gaby Moserwho average near .370 and have accumulated 20 RBIs. Courtney Wilson leads the team with 16 goals and Tatum Villotta has a team high nine runs. Clara Edwards won 16 games a year ago as a freshman and has watched the Coyotes’ 13 games this season. Five launches were made by Kori Wedeking who was an NJCAA All-American at Kirkwood a year ago. Kirkwood is 20 minutes north of Iowa City.
Iowa (8-6, 0-0 Big Ten)
Within the Hawkeyes’ 8-6 record that year is a 1-2 loss to then-No. 1 UCLA and another 2-1 loss to Oregon State. These took place last weekend in Palm Springs, California. It was freshman pitcher Jalen Adams who went toe-to-toe with the Bruins, and she boasts a team-high .79 ERA in 26 innings. Only eight strikeouts in this record, but only three walks. Junior Denali Loecker led Iowa with 10 home runs last year, the second-highest in program history, and was also Iowa’s top pitcher. She has four homers and a .478 average in 14 games and is 1-0 in the circle with a 2.88 ERA in 17 innings.
Central Arkansas (11-3, 0-0 ASUN)
The Bears made the first and only NCAA tournament appearance in 2015 and have been on the verge of a return in recent years. Central Arkansas was a runner-up to Conference Champion Liberty last year but is bringing back the best parts of last year’s 37-win team. Veteran pitchers Kayla Beaver and Jordan Johnson take center stage. Both are carrying ERAs below 2.00 this year. Beaver has won 21 games in each of the last two seasons. Outfielders Tremere Harris and Jenna Wildeman stole 47 combined bases last year, while Morgan Nelson and Jaylee Engelkes combined 23 homers. UCA beats .227 as a team and so does their opponents.
Alcorn State (3-9)
Eugenia Fernandez was named Alcorn State’s head coach in early November after previously working as an assistant at Florida A&M from 2014-16. Fernandez played professionally for Columbia for more than a decade. Fernandez’ Lady Braves competed in Mississippi for the first two weekends of the season. A doubleheader at Nichols State on February 22 was her final competition. Alcorn State’s returnees include pitchers Kiri Parker (1-4, 6.70 ERA) and Alexa Veamoi (1-3, 5.33 ERA). Kristian Edwards hit .324 with nine triples and two home runs last year. She was also 28 of 28 on the base paths for a team that stole 77 bases. Edwards has five of Alcorn’s 19 steals this season.
